Sauerkraut And Macaroni

Prep: 15 min Cook: 30 min Serves: 4 Cuisine: American

A hearty and savory combination of sauerkraut, macaroni, and stir-fried pork, flavored with bacon, onion, pimento, and herbs—perfect for comfort food lovers. Suitable for a filling meal.

Ingredients

  • 1 quart sauerkraut
  • 1 slice bacon, cut into thin pieces
  • 1 medium onion, sliced lengthwise
  • 1 chicken or beef bouillon cube
  • 1 cup hot water
  • 3 to 4 tablespoons cornstarch
  • 1 package (7 oz.) elbow macaroni
  • 1 1/2 pounds stir-fry pork
  • 1 tablespoon oil
  • 1 tablespoon parsley flakes
  • 2 teaspoons chopped pimento
  • dash garlic salt

Instructions

  1. Cook sauerkraut, bacon, and onion until kraut is tender.
  2. Cook macaroni according to package directions and drain well.
  3. Cook stir-fry pork in a tablespoon of oil.
  4. Add parsley flakes, chopped pimento, garlic salt, salt, and pepper to the pork.
  5. Mix cornstarch with a cup of chicken broth and cook until thickened.
  6. Combine the cooked macaroni, sauerkraut mixture, and thickened broth.
  7. Heat through and serve.

Tips & Substitutions

For a smoky flavor, consider using smoked bacon or adding a touch of smoked paprika. You can substitute elbow macaroni with any pasta shape, such as shells or penne. If you prefer a vegetarian version, replace the bacon with sautéed mushrooms and use vegetable broth instead of chicken. Adjust the seasoning to taste, especially if you use low-sodium broth.

Serving Suggestions

Serve this hearty dish alongside a simple green salad or crusty bread for a complete meal. For a comforting touch, pair it with a side of warm garlic bread. Storage & Reheating

Leftovers can be stored in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. To reheat, gently warm in a saucepan over medium heat, adding a splash of water or broth to prevent drying out. You can also microwave in a covered dish, stirring occasionally until heated through.

Frequently Asked Questions

Can I use fresh sauerkraut instead of canned?

Yes, you can use fresh sauerkraut! Just make sure to rinse it to reduce the saltiness, and adjust the cooking time as needed, cooking until it's tender and flavorful.

What can I use instead of bouillon cubes?

If you don’t have bouillon cubes, you can use homemade chicken or beef broth, or a liquid broth substitute. Just be mindful of the salt content and adjust the seasoning accordingly.

How can I make this dish spicier?

To add some heat, consider incorporating crushed red pepper flakes or diced jalapeños into the pork mixture. You can also serve it with a side of hot sauce for those who enjoy extra spice.
